- Forex Basics: Relative Strength Index
By: Martin Chandra | - Relative Strength Index was developed by J.Welles Wilder Jr. and introduced in his book 'New Concepts In Technical Trading Systems'. It is one of the most popular technical tools around.
Relative strength Index (RSI) is measured on a scale from 0-100 with a reading above 70 being overbought and a reading below 30 being oversold. - What I Learnt Losing $60,000 My First Year As A Full-time Trader
By: Martin Chandra | - During my first year as a local (independent trader) on the floor of LIFFE, I bought and sold 8804 FTSE futures contracts, about 40 contracts per day on average. The result was a loss of $61,620 or -$267 per trading day. I was profitable on 55% of days with an average gain of $1009, my average loosing day was -$1780. My biggest one day gain was $7730 and my biggest loss -$12,426.
